In this quote, Bill Cosby recognizes the extraordinary comedic talents of George Carlin and Johnny Winters, emphasizing their unique ability to work with words. He highlights Carlin’s brilliance in using language to make deep, often philosophical observations in a humorous way. For Carlin, comedy wasn’t just about jokes; it was about wordplay and clever manipulation of language to convey meaning and provoke thought. His ability to make common phrases or societal norms seem absurd was part of what made him so influential in comedy.

Similarly, Cosby appreciates Johnny Winters' creativity in approaching humor. Winters was known for his unconventional and often eccentric style, taking everyday situations and drawing out the humor that others might miss. Unlike typical comedians who rely on punchlines, Winters found humor in the unexpected, often creating humor by exaggerating the familiar or by seeing the world through a different lens. His creativity lay in his ability to turn the mundane into something extraordinary.

Cosby’s point about taking something common and turning it into humor speaks to a shared skill between Carlin and Winters: they both had a knack for seeing the humor in the ordinary and making it resonate with audiences. By being clever with words, they could take an everyday situation or topic and make it fresh, funny, and often thought-provoking. This skill in wordplay and creativity is what made both comedians stand out.

In summary, Bill Cosby’s quote highlights the art of using language as a tool for humor, emphasizing how both George Carlin and Johnny Winters excelled in drawing out humor from the common, being clever with language and turning the ordinary into something remarkable. Their ability to transform everyday ideas into jokes speaks to their genius as wordsmiths and creative thinkers.
